Position Overview:

Provides technical and administrative support to the department leader. Supports services can include processing/credentialing of provider applications of the staff, attendance at designated medical staff department and committee meetings, as well as support services. Functions are performed in accordance with the Medical Staff Bylaws, Rules and Regulations; The Joint Commission (TJC) and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) Standards; other Federal and State Regulations, such as Title 22; and Department Policies & Procedures.
